没加密的3A游戏怎么玩,深度解析与实用技巧没加密的3a游戏怎么玩

没加密的3A游戏怎么玩,深度解析与实用技巧没加密的3a游戏怎么玩,

本文目录导读:

  1. 什么是游戏加密
  2. 如何破解未加密的游戏
  3. 未加密游戏的高级操作技巧
  4. 注意事项

好,用户让我写一篇关于“没加密的3A游戏怎么玩”的文章,还给了一个示例标题和内容,我需要理解用户的需求,他们可能对加密技术在游戏中的应用不太了解,或者想了解如何在没有加密保护的游戏里进行一些操作。 用户提供的示例标题是“没加密的3A游戏怎么玩:深度解析与实用技巧”,看起来已经很全面了,内容部分分为几个部分,从基本操作到高级技巧,再到注意事项,最后是总结,这可能是一个结构合理、内容详尽的文章。 我需要考虑用户可能的深层需求,他们可能不仅想知道如何操作,还可能关心游戏安全、技术风险以及游戏体验的问题,在写作时,我应该涵盖这些方面,提供实用的建议,同时提醒用户注意潜在的风险。 用户要求文章不少于3104个字,这意味着内容需要足够详细,我需要确保每个部分都有足够的扩展,比如在“基本操作”部分详细说明如何破解文件格式,或者在“高级技巧”中探讨反编译和动态分析的具体方法。 我还需要考虑读者的背景,如果读者是游戏爱好者,他们可能对技术细节不太熟悉,所以需要用通俗易懂的语言解释技术术语,如果读者是开发者或安全研究人员,可能需要更深入的技术细节。 总结部分应该强调虽然可以操作这些游戏,但必须遵守法律和道德规范,保护个人隐私和知识产权,这不仅符合用户的需求,也符合社会责任。 我需要确保文章结构清晰,内容详尽,语言易懂,同时涵盖用户可能关心的各个方面,满足他们的深层需求。

随着3A游戏(即 AAA 游戏,通常指画质和性能极高的商业游戏)的普及,玩家对游戏体验的要求越来越高,随着技术的进步,一些游戏为了防止reverse工程、修改或破解,会选择对游戏文件进行加密处理,这种加密技术不仅保护了游戏的完整性和版权,也让一些玩家望而却步,对于一些技术爱好者或开发者来说,了解如何破解或 bypass 这些加密措施,可以为游戏的开发和优化提供便利,本文将深入探讨如何操作未加密的3A游戏,并提供一些实用的技巧和注意事项。


什么是游戏加密

游戏加密是指游戏开发者对游戏文件(如游戏数据、脚本、插件等)进行加密处理,以防止未经授权的修改、复制或传播,加密技术通常采用现代密码学算法,确保只有经过授权的工具或设备才能解密和操作这些文件。

  1. 加密的目的

    • 保护版权:防止其他玩家未经授权修改或破解游戏。
    • 防止反编译:保护游戏的核心代码,防止被逆向工程以获取商业机密。
    • 确保数据安全:防止游戏数据被非法获取或传播。
  2. 常见的加密方式

    • 文件加密:对游戏的二进制文件进行加密,如.exe、.dll等。
    • 数据加密:对游戏中的关键数据(如插件、脚本)进行加密。
    • API加密:对游戏的API(应用程序编程接口)进行加密,防止被截获或滥用。

如何破解未加密的游戏

如果游戏文件没有经过加密处理,玩家可以通过以下方法进行操作:

直接运行未加密的游戏

对于未加密的游戏,玩家可以直接将其放入计算机的运行目录中进行体验,这种情况下,游戏的完整性和功能不会受到影响。

使用反编译工具

反编译工具是一种将二进制文件转换为可读代码的工具,通过反编译游戏的可执行文件(*.exe),玩家可以查看游戏的代码结构,了解游戏的运行逻辑和实现细节。

  • 反编译工具推荐
    • IDA Pro:一款功能强大的反编译工具,支持多种操作系统和文件格式。
    • Ghidra:一款开源的反编译工具,适合学习和研究。

使用游戏修改器

游戏修改器是一种允许玩家修改游戏文件的工具,通过修改器,玩家可以调整游戏的配置、添加或删除插件、修改游戏的脚本等。

  • 常用修改器
    • Steam Workshop:适用于 Steam 游戏的修改器,支持添加、删除和修改插件。
    • Game Expander:一款功能强大的修改器,支持多种游戏的文件操作。

使用脚本编辑器

脚本编辑器是一种用于修改游戏脚本的工具,通过脚本编辑器,玩家可以修改游戏的动画、声音、NPC行为等细节。

  • 常用脚本编辑器
    • Unity Editor:适用于 Unity 游戏引擎的脚本编辑。
    • Unreal Engine Editor:适用于 Unreal Engine 游戏引擎的脚本编辑。

使用暴力破解工具

暴力破解工具是一种通过暴力手段(如暴力破解)获取游戏密钥或破解信息的工具,这种方法通常用于商业游戏,但需要注意的是,使用暴力破解工具可能会违反游戏开发商的使用条款,甚至涉及法律问题。


未加密游戏的高级操作技巧

  1. 动态分析

    • 动态分析是一种通过运行游戏并监控其运行时行为来分析游戏代码的技术,这种方法可以用于了解游戏的运行逻辑、识别关键代码路径等。
    • 工具推荐:Wireshark、GDB(GNU Debugger)。
  2. 反编译与动态分析结合

    通过反编译和动态分析,玩家可以更深入地了解游戏的代码结构和实现细节,这种方法通常用于游戏开发和优化。

  3. 文件系统操作

    对于需要修改游戏文件的玩家来说,文件系统的操作是基础,通过文件编辑器(如Notepad++、Hex Editor)可以对游戏的二进制文件进行直接修改。

  4. 插件开发

    • 插件是一种可以增强游戏功能的独立程序,通过编写插件,玩家可以添加新的功能、修改游戏的配置等。
    • 插件开发工具推荐:Unity 插件 SDK、Unreal 插件 SDK。

注意事项

  1. 遵守法律和道德规范

    • 使用反编译、修改器等工具时,必须遵守游戏开发商的使用条款,避免侵犯版权。
    • 不要使用非法手段(如暴力破解)获取游戏密钥或破解信息。
  2. 保护个人隐私

    • 在操作未加密的游戏时,要确保自己的操作不会被追踪或记录。
    • 避免在公共网络上运行或分享未加密的游戏文件。
  3. 网络安全

    • 在进行文件操作时,要确保自己的计算机安全,避免感染恶意软件。
    • 不要随意下载或分享未知来源的文件。
  4. 技术风险

    • 使用反编译、修改器等工具可能会导致游戏性能下降或功能异常。
    • 不要尝试修改游戏的核心代码,以免影响游戏的稳定性。
没加密的3A游戏怎么玩,深度解析与实用技巧没加密的3a游戏怎么玩,

发表评论